Thank you for choosing to renew your membership and/or certification with the United Council on Welfare Fraud. Being a member of UCOWF makes you part of an organization of investigators, administrators, prosecutors, eligibility and claims specialists from local, state and federal agencies from the United States and Canada who have combined their efforts to fight fraud, waste, and abuse in public assistance programs.

MEMBERSHIP RENEWAL PROCEDURES
To renew your UCOWF Membership, complete the renewal form online and save the form on your desktop. If paying by credit card, email the completed form to ucowf@comcast.net.
If paying via check, money order or your organization pays your membership, complete the form, print it and forward it with your payment to the address on the document (or to your organization for payment).
CWFI CERTIFICATION RENEWAL PROCEDURES
To renew your CWFI certification, complete the renewal form online and save the form on your desktop. If paying by credit card, email the completed form to ucowf@comcast.net.
If paying via check, money order or your organization pays your certification renewal, complete the form, print it and forward it with your payment to the address on the document (or to your organization for payment).
Print out the Continuing Education Form, complete all portions of it, have the training hours certified by your supervisor or training coordinator and mail both the CWFI renewal and CWFI Continuing Education Report with check or money order to PO Box 226948, Miami, Florida 33222-6948.
If you pay by credit card, you can send your completed membership and/or CWFI renewal form via email. The CWFI Continuing Education Form MUST be mailed.

Your membership is important to many ways. For the organization, your membership gives us more influence with public assistance program policy makers in establishing sound procedures and rules that strengthen the integrity of public assistance programs across the North American continent. Your concerns can be addressed to program administrators and help amend current program rules and procedures that provide an avenue for those who leverage weaknesses in the social services program rules for their own monetary gain.
You annual dues help fund the operation of UCOWF. The United Council on Welfare Fraud is a non-profit organization and relies on its members and its conference revenues to provide the financial foundation for its continued existence.
Being a member of a professional organization has its value in terms of what it can do for you. Our membership directory gives you an instant source for contacts within and outside of your state or province for investigative assistance. The UCOWF Listserv gives you access to all subscribed members who receive the listserv messages and who can provide information and feedback on operational or administrative issues that your agency faces. The UCOWF Newsletter provides information on current activities and planned events such as the Annual Training Conference as well as notice of emerging trends reported in public assistance fraud.
As a Certified Welfare Fraud Investigator, your skills and level of professionalism have been tested and measured. Among peers, a CWFI has distinguished him or herself by achieving and maintaining the level of skills and knowledge that can be the difference when being considered for advancement.
